package ui import ( "fmt" "github.com/jroimartin/gocui" "strings" "unicode" ) var translate = map[string]string{ "/": "Slash", "\\": "Backslash", "[": "LsqBracket", "]": "RsqBracket", "_": "Underscore", "escape": "Esc", "~": "Tilde", "pageup": "Pgup", "pagedown": "Pgdn", "pgup": "Pgup", "pgdown": "Pgdn", // "up": "ArrowUp", // "down": "ArrowDown", // "right": "ArrowRight", // "left": "ArrowLeft", "ctl": "Ctrl", } var display = map[string]string{ "Slash": "/", "Backslash": "\\", "LsqBracket": "[", "RsqBracket": "]", "Underscore": "_", "Tilde": "~", "Ctrl": "^", } var supportedKeybindings = map[string]gocui.Key{ "KeyF1": gocui.KeyF1, "KeyF2": gocui.KeyF2, "KeyF3": gocui.KeyF3, "KeyF4": gocui.KeyF4, "KeyF5": gocui.KeyF5, "KeyF6": gocui.KeyF6, "KeyF7": gocui.KeyF7, "KeyF8": gocui.KeyF8, "KeyF9": gocui.KeyF9, "KeyF10": gocui.KeyF10, "KeyF11": gocui.KeyF11, "KeyF12": gocui.KeyF12, "KeyInsert": gocui.KeyInsert, "KeyDelete": gocui.KeyDelete, "KeyHome": gocui.KeyHome, "KeyEnd": gocui.KeyEnd, "KeyPgup": gocui.KeyPgup, "KeyPgdn": gocui.KeyPgdn, // "KeyArrowUp": gocui.KeyArrowUp, // "KeyArrowDown": gocui.KeyArrowDown, // "KeyArrowLeft": gocui.KeyArrowLeft, // "KeyArrowRight": gocui.KeyArrowRight, "KeyCtrlTilde": gocui.KeyCtrlTilde, "KeyCtrl2": gocui.KeyCtrl2, "KeyCtrlSpace": gocui.KeyCtrlSpace, "KeyCtrlA": gocui.KeyCtrlA, "KeyCtrlB": gocui.KeyCtrlB, "KeyCtrlC": gocui.KeyCtrlC, "KeyCtrlD": gocui.KeyCtrlD, "KeyCtrlE": gocui.KeyCtrlE, "KeyCtrlF": gocui.KeyCtrlF, "KeyCtrlG": gocui.KeyCtrlG, "KeyBackspace": gocui.KeyBackspace, "KeyCtrlH": gocui.KeyCtrlH, "KeyTab": gocui.KeyTab, "KeyCtrlI": gocui.KeyCtrlI, "KeyCtrlJ": gocui.KeyCtrlJ, "KeyCtrlK": gocui.KeyCtrlK, "KeyCtrlL": gocui.KeyCtrlL, "KeyEnter": gocui.KeyEnter, "KeyCtrlM": gocui.KeyCtrlM, "KeyCtrlN": gocui.KeyCtrlN, "KeyCtrlO": gocui.KeyCtrlO, "KeyCtrlP": gocui.KeyCtrlP, "KeyCtrlQ": gocui.KeyCtrlQ, "KeyCtrlR": gocui.KeyCtrlR, "KeyCtrlS": gocui.KeyCtrlS, "KeyCtrlT": gocui.KeyCtrlT, "KeyCtrlU": gocui.KeyCtrlU, "KeyCtrlV": gocui.KeyCtrlV, "KeyCtrlW": gocui.KeyCtrlW, "KeyCtrlX": gocui.KeyCtrlX, "KeyCtrlY": gocui.KeyCtrlY, "KeyCtrlZ": gocui.KeyCtrlZ, "KeyEsc": gocui.KeyEsc, "KeyCtrlLsqBracket": gocui.KeyCtrlLsqBracket, "KeyCtrl3": gocui.KeyCtrl3, "KeyCtrl4": gocui.KeyCtrl4, "KeyCtrlBackslash": gocui.KeyCtrlBackslash, "KeyCtrl5": gocui.KeyCtrl5, "KeyCtrlRsqBracket": gocui.KeyCtrlRsqBracket, "KeyCtrl6": gocui.KeyCtrl6, "KeyCtrl7": gocui.KeyCtrl7, "KeyCtrlSlash": gocui.KeyCtrlSlash, "KeyCtrlUnderscore": gocui.KeyCtrlUnderscore, "KeySpace": gocui.KeySpace, "KeyBackspace2": gocui.KeyBackspace2, "KeyCtrl8": gocui.KeyCtrl8, } type Key struct { value gocui.Key modifier gocui.Modifier tokens []string input string } func getKeybinding(input string) (Key, error) { f := func(c rune) bool { return unicode.IsSpace(c) || c == '+' } tokens := strings.FieldsFunc(input, f) var normalizedTokens []string var modifier = gocui.ModNone for _, token := range tokens { normalized := strings.ToLower(token) if value, exists := translate[normalized]; exists { normalized = value } else { normalized = strings.Title(normalized) } if normalized == "Alt" { modifier = gocui.ModAlt continue } if len(normalized) == 1 { normalizedTokens = append(normalizedTokens, strings.ToUpper(normalized)) continue } normalizedTokens = append(normalizedTokens, normalized) } lookup := "Key" + strings.Join(normalizedTokens, "") if key, exists := supportedKeybindings[lookup]; exists { return Key{key, modifier, normalizedTokens, input}, nil } if modifier != gocui.ModNone { return Key{0, modifier, normalizedTokens, input}, fmt.Errorf("unsupported keybinding: %s (+%+v)", lookup, modifier) } return Key{0, modifier, normalizedTokens, input}, fmt.Errorf("unsupported keybinding: %s", lookup) } func getKeybindings(input string) []Key { ret := make([]Key, 0) for _, value := range strings.Split(input, ",") { key, err := getKeybinding(value) if err != nil { panic(fmt.Errorf("could not parse keybinding '%s' from request '%s': %+v", value, input, err)) } ret = append(ret, key) } if len(ret) == 0 { panic(fmt.Errorf("must have at least one keybinding")) } return ret } func (key Key) String() string { displayTokens := make([]string, 0) prefix := "" for _, token := range key.tokens { if token == "Ctrl" { prefix = "^" continue } if value, exists := display[token]; exists { token = value } displayTokens = append(displayTokens, token) } return prefix + strings.Join(displayTokens, "+") }
